What Are Bronze Grave Markers? Bronze grave markers are memorial plaques made from a durable metal designed for outdoor use. They are usually installed on a granite base and include engraved details such as names, dates, and meaningful symbols. These markers are commonly used in cemeteries because they remain strong over time and maintain a clean, respectful appearance. What Makes Bronze Markers Different From Other Memorial Options? When families compare memorial materials, they often look at durability, appearance, and maintenance. Bronze stands out because it offers a balance of all three. Unlike some materials that may crack or fade, bronze forms a natural surface layer that helps protect it over time. This allows it to maintain both its appearance and strength even in outdoor conditions. Bronze markers are often chosen because they offer: Long-term durability Resistance to weather and environmental changes A classic and timeless appearance The ability to include detailed personal designs These qualities make bronze a reliable option for families who want a memorial that continues to look meaningful over the years. When Bronze Markers May Not Be the Right Option While bronze is a strong and reliable material, it may not always be the best fit. Some cemeteries have specific guidelines about the type of markers allowed. It is important to check these requirements before making a decision. In other cases, families may prefer a different style of memorial based on personal or cultural preferences. Taking the time to understand your options can help you make a more confident choice. How Bronze Grave Markers Hold Up Over Time A common concern is how a memorial will look years from now. Bronze markers are designed to last for decades and remain readable over time. As they age, they form a natural layer that helps protect against damage. This allows them to maintain their appearance even when exposed to outdoor conditions. Because of this, bronze is often considered one of the most dependable materials for long-term memorial use.
